New Tulum Airport to Boost Tourism and Preserve Mayan Culture

Posted by John on August 3, 2023
0

Tulum, Mexico is a popular tourist destination known for its stunning beaches, ancient ruins, and Mayan culture. In recent years, the number of visitors to Tulum has exploded, and the current airport in Cancun is struggling to keep up with demand.

To help alleviate the congestion at Cancun Airport, the Mexican government is building a new international airport in Tulum. The airport is located about 15 kilometers west of Tulum, near the town of Felipe Carrillo Puerto. It is scheduled to open in December 2023.

The new airport will have a capacity of 5.5 million passengers per year. It will have a single runway that is 3,700 meters long. The airport will also have a passenger terminal, a cargo terminal, and a military base.

The construction of the new airport is a major investment in the future of Tulum. It is expected to boost tourism in the region and create jobs. The airport is also expected to help reduce the environmental impact of air travel by diverting some traffic from Cancun Airport.

Economic Benefits

The new Tulum Airport is expected to have a significant economic impact on the region. It is estimated that the airport will create over 10,000 jobs during construction and over 5,000 permanent jobs once it is operational. The airport is also expected to generate over $1 billion in economic activity each year.

Tourism Benefits

The new Tulum Airport will make it easier for tourists to visit Tulum and other nearby destinations. It is expected to attract more tourists to the region, which will boost the local economy. The airport is also expected to help Tulum become a more competitive tourist destination.

Environmental Benefits

The new Tulum Airport is designed to be environmentally friendly. The airport will be powered by renewable energy sources, and it will have a number of other features that will help reduce its environmental impact. For example, the airport will be built on an area that is already cleared, which will help to preserve the surrounding rainforest.

Cultural Benefits

The new Tulum Airport is also expected to help preserve the Mayan culture. The airport will be located near the archaeological site of Tulum, which is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The airport is expected to help raise awareness of the Mayan culture and attract more tourists to the region.

The new Tulum Airport is a major development for the Riviera Maya region. It is expected to boost tourism, create jobs, and help preserve the Mayan culture. The airport is scheduled to open in December 2023, and it is sure to be a popular destination for travelers from all over the world.
